Wrapper, ice cream: Tootsie Roll Fudge Bar. Big Twin. Licensed by Tootsie Roll Industries, Chicago, n.d., ca. 1966-1975.
Archive
Printed sleeve ice cream wrapper: Tootsie Roll Fudge Bar. Big Twin. Printed embossed glassine envelope, 2-11/16" x 8" long with 1-1/8" gusset.
Big Twin presumably refers to a popsicle-style product with two sticks.
The product (a modern food laboratory product as seen by the ingredients list) that this wrapper was made for was NOT made in Hoboken or by the Sweets Company of America, makers of Tootsie Roll brand items, which was its name when it was in Hoboken. Renamed Tootsie Roll Industries, Inc. when it left Hoboken for Chicago. This popsicle was a licensed product under that company (see text below of side panel.) The Sweets Company when it was in Hoboken DID sell Tootsie Roll brand Ice Cream products from the 1950s onward, but the products themselves were not made here. The wrapper here is held as an example of the extension of that product line and not as a Hoboken manufactured product.
On side panel:
Ingredients: A quiescently frozen dairy confection containing water, cane & corn sugar, non-fat milk solids, cocoa, malt, vegetable stabilizers, emulsifier, salt, corn syrup, vegetable oil, condensed skim milk, whey powder, vegetable lecithin, vanillin (an artificial flavoring), natural & artificial flavors.
Tootsie Roll is a Registered Trade Mark and is licensed by Tootsie Roll Industries, Inc., Chicago, Illinois 60629.
Text from other panels:
A Nice Product.
3 fluid ounces.
U.S. Patent 3,035,754. [patent is for the wrapper, not the frozen food product]
C.D.P. Co., 101 E. Main St., Okla. City, Olka. 73104.
Advertisement on back for Lifetime Identification Social Security Plates.
